
Film maker Dinesh D’Souza was recently asked by Rob Bluey, the president and executive editor ofย The Daily Signal, “How can we live in a country where people hold such diametrically opposing views?“
DโSouza answered that he thinks “the problem is serious, but it is not quite as bad as we think for this reason.”

“The people on the Trump side, on the Republican side, are making a balanced judgment about Trump because theyโre exposed to Trump, theyโre exposed to the defenses of Trump, and theyโre also exposed to the criticism of Trump, because none of us can avoid the mainstream media in our lives.”
“We see it,” he said. “We know about it. But now look at the other side, and Iโm talking here about the rank-and-file Democrat.”
“The rank-and-file Democrat does not actually know a lot about Trump. They do not get the pro-Trump side at all. They get a nonstop propagandistic diet of anti-Trump polemic. If CNN has a panel of 17 people, theyโre all anti-Trump. There may be two or three Republicans, but theyโre selected because theyโre anti-Trump.”

“So as a result, one is forgiven, because think about it, when youโre an intelligent person, how do discover a fact, right? You discover a fact when you see that fact appear in multiple sources, sources that you admittedly cannot check for yourself, but you think to yourself, well, if I see it in Barnes and Noble in a book, and then there it is on PBS, there it is on the history channel, there it is and Michael Moore made a film about it, Rachel Maddowโs talking about it, and here it is in the New York Times, well, it must be true, because why would all these independent people have made this up, the same thing?”
“They donโt realize that itโs actually more like the same bullet ricocheting off multiple walls and coming at you from different directions,” he continued. “You think that youโre getting independent sources of information, not realizing that all these people, not that they are conspiring together, but theyโre more like birds in a flying formation going to Florida, all flying side by side in the same pattern.”

“Itโs really based upon the presumption that the ordinary guy is a real buffoon, but itโs also based on the idea that the ordinary guy reacts only emotionally and not rationally. Well, the nice thing about a film is that a film operates primarily on the emotional medium, for sure.”
“Thatโs why films have a score. If you want to know what that music is doing under the film, it is regulating your emotions as you watch the film.”
“The good news is that if you do a good job with the emotional narrative, you can pack a lot of genuine, thoughtful information in a film, but if you make the mistake of making a film that has lots of thoughtful information but doesnโt have the emotional component, the film will not succeed.”
